OK so I crashed my Mavic into a tree four days ago.  It fell from about 20 feet onto its back.  I put the battery back in and checked for any visible damage and have since flown it five more times.  I have not encountered any issues flying it around put when I RTH it will speed up to 12 MPH and brake to a stop and speed back up and brake to a stop the entire time it is RTH.  Dows anyone know what this might be?
